Number of roles opened and closed for Software Engineers in Belgium in the last 3 months

Number of roles opened and closed for Software Engineers in Belgium in the last 3 months

The software engineering job market in Belgium has demonstrated notable fluctuations over the past 12 weeks. The peak in new job openings occurred in week 27 with 620 positions posted, reflecting a robust demand for software engineers. However, this surge contrasts with a significant number of closures, peaking at 791 in week 24, suggesting potential challenges in candidate retention or project completion. Seniority distribution of Software Engineer job openings in Belgium

Seniority Distribution of Software Engineering Jobs in Belgium

In the competitive software engineer job market in Belgium, the seniority distribution reveals key insights for hiring managers. Mid-Senior level positions dominate with 54% of the total job postings, followed by Entry level roles at 39%, and Associate positions comprising 19%. Understanding these proportions is essential for recruitment strategies aimed at attracting top talent in Belgium's tech sector.

Chart about preferred employment type for Engineering roles in Belgium

Preferred employment type for Engineering roles in Belgium

In the Belgian software job market, full-time positions dominate, accounting for 90% of employment types, while contract roles represent 9% and part-time opportunities constitute 1%. This distribution underscores the significant preference for stability in employment among Software Engineers, highlighting the importance of full-time roles in attracting and retaining top talent. Most popular cities in Belgium to hire Software Engineers

Top 5 cities in Belgium to hire Software Engineers

In Belgium's software engineering job market, Brussels stands out as the primary hub, accounting for 55% of the total job openings with 5,457 positions available. Following Brussels, Antwerp holds a significant share with 15% of the opportunities, totaling 1,501 positions, while Ghent contributes 9% with 939 job openings. This data underscores the concentration of software developer opportunities within these major urban centers, particularly highlighting the capital's dominance in attracting software talent.
